About The Castle of Mey and Animal Centre
The Castle of Mey was the property of Queen Elizabeth The Queen Mother from 1952 until 1996, when Her Majesty generously gifted it with an endowment to the Trust.
The castle itself is fascinatingly developed and decorated, with informative guides and historical markers leading the way. The gardens are equally impressive and make for excellent photo opportunities.
The new Animal Centre is based in the old granary and is enjoyed by children and adults alike. The relaxed and welcoming atmosphere gives them the opportunity to see animals well cared for in a happy environment. Visitors can have hands-on, supervised contact with some of the animals, providing an enjoyable and educational visit.
